SeamFil Kits are designed to provide users with the necessary tools to create their own custom SeamFil color matches to make successful laminate repairs. Kits provide 11 tubes of popular SeamFil colors, Retarder, a ½ pint of SF-99 Solvent, a Putty Knife and a Mixing Guide. SeamFil is a user friendly product that allows for various colors to be easily blended together, giving the user control of the final color match. SeamFil has been sold in this format, as a kit box, for over 60 years and it remains a popular product because of the flexibility it gives users. 

SeamFil has been used to repair small nicks and gouges (1/4” in diameter or smaller) in laminate surfaces commonly found in kitchens and bathrooms since the 1950’s. It is the “original” laminate repair product. SeamFil is also designed to be used to fill seams between sheets of laminate, as its name implies.

SeamFil quickly and easily fixes damaged areas or fills seams found on laminate surfaces. This product dries fast and is easy to clean up using SF-99 solvent, which is specifically designed to be used in conjunction with SeamFil. Retarder may be used to slow the curing process, thus giving the user more time to mix colors and create the perfect color match. SeamFil laminate repair bonds to the substrate of

laminate and dries hard, becoming a permanent part of the laminate surface. SeamFil resists moisture, detergents, and other household products in a similar manner to the original laminate. Common applications for this product include filling standard joints, cracks and chips on laminate countertops and furniture where the laminate’s substrate is visible. When properly used, SeamFil laminate repair will hide damages for many years. 

SeamFil color matching guides are available for the major laminate manufacturers — Formica, Wilsonart, Nevamar and Pionite.
